FNDX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2017 in Review
77 of the 4,034 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Schwab Fundamental US Large Company Index ETF (FNDX) for Q1 2017, worth a combined $1.8B — up 28% from $1.41B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 10 funds opened new FNDX positions and 5 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 37 added to existing stakes and 14 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Charles Schwab Investment Advisory, adding an estimated $323M. The largest seller was Zeke Capital Advisors, cutting an estimated $6.76M.
